Panther hands down.
Ive put way more effort, into trying to keep my jackson alive by FAR.
After a year, I still cant seem to get it 100% right. ;/
My panther, well he pretty much runs himself compared to my jackson.
I dont even "worry" about him honestly, my jackson, I worry about constantly. ;/
They are not really "harder" though, Id say their bodies appear to be much less "forgiving" of our errors though.
